在 codeigniter 中获取超过 24 小时的所有记录
Get all records older than 24 hours in codeigniter
我想从 sql table 获取所有超过 24 小时的数据,因为我
已编写以下查询,但无法正常工作。
$this->db->where('DATE(`created_at`) <','strtotime(-1 days)')->get('table_name')->result();
created_at is of date time data type.
试试 INTERVAL
$this->db->where("DATE(`created_at`) + INTERVAL 1 DAY < NOW() ")->get('table_name')->result();
阅读更多
- find if date is older than 30 days
我想从 sql table 获取所有超过 24 小时的数据,因为我 已编写以下查询,但无法正常工作。
$this->db->where('DATE(`created_at`) <','strtotime(-1 days)')->get('table_name')->result();
created_at is of date time data type.
试试 INTERVAL
$this->db->where("DATE(`created_at`) + INTERVAL 1 DAY < NOW() ")->get('table_name')->result();
阅读更多
- find if date is older than 30 days